Residential Fumigation in Toledo, OH
Residential fumigation services involve the controlled application of pest control treatments to eliminate infestations within homes and other residential properties. This process is often used to address severe pest problems such as termites, bed bugs, or other persistent insects that are difficult to eradicate with standard treatments. Projects typically include entire structures or specific areas that require thorough treatment to ensure pests are fully removed and do not return. Homeowners should understand that fumigation is a comprehensive approach that may involve temporarily vacating the property and preparing the space according to specific instructions to ensure safety and effectiveness.

Residential Fumigation Questions
What is residential fumigation? Residential fumigation involves treating an entire property to eliminate pests such as termites, bed bugs, or other invasive insects effectively.
When should a property be fumigated? Fumigation is recommended when pest infestations are severe or persistent, and other treatment methods have not been successful.
How should a property be prepared for fumigation? Preparation typically includes removing food, personal items, and opening vents to ensure safety and effectiveness during the treatment.
Is fumigation safe for residents and pets? Fumigation is performed with safety precautions in place, and residents should follow guidance on when it is safe to re-enter the property after treatment.
